Mandatory Items of Cold Weather Gear

The mandatory items encompass a range of clothing and accessories designed to provide comprehensive protection. These items are essential for maintaining body temperature and preventing the onset of cold-related illnesses. The following items are crucial for survival in extreme cold.

  • Outer Shell Jacket: Designed for wind and water resistance, this jacket provides the primary barrier against the elements. It typically features a waterproof and breathable outer layer, ensuring that moisture is effectively shed while maintaining body warmth. Examples include Gore-Tex or similar high-performance fabrics.
  • Insulating Mid-Layer Jacket: This jacket is critical for trapping warm air and providing additional insulation. Commonly made from materials like fleece or down, these mid-layers enhance warmth without adding significant bulk.
  • Moisture-wicking Base Layers: Base layers are crucial for maintaining a dry inner layer, preventing moisture buildup and regulating body temperature. They are typically made of moisture-wicking fabrics that draw sweat away from the skin, preventing chill and discomfort.
  • Cold Weather Pants: These pants are designed with the same principles of water resistance and insulation as the jacket, offering comprehensive protection for the lower body.
  • Waterproof and Insulated Gloves/Mittens: Essential for protecting hands from extreme cold, these gloves/mittens are available in various insulation levels. They must be waterproof to prevent moisture from penetrating and causing discomfort or injury.
  • Cold Weather Boots: Designed for warmth and protection from ice and snow, these boots must meet specific insulation and water resistance standards. They often feature waterproof and insulated construction.

Cleaning and Maintenance Procedures

Regular cleaning and maintenance are essential for preserving the integrity of cold weather gear. This involves a systematic approach to remove dirt, debris, and moisture, which can degrade the materials over time. The specific cleaning methods depend on the type of fabric and materials.

  • Pre-Cleaning Inspection: Before commencing any cleaning process, thoroughly inspect the gear for any obvious damage or wear. This preliminary assessment helps identify potential issues and guides the subsequent cleaning and repair steps.
  • Cleaning Methods: Utilize mild detergent and lukewarm water for most fabrics. Avoid harsh chemicals or excessive heat, as these can damage the gear’s waterproof and insulating properties. Hand washing is often preferred over machine washing to prevent stretching or damage to the fabric. Specific care instructions for each garment type are critical, ensuring compliance with manufacturer recommendations.
  • Drying Procedures: Never use a clothes dryer for cold weather gear. Excessive heat can shrink or damage the fabric, compromising its insulation and waterproof qualities. Instead, allow the gear to air dry completely, ideally in a well-ventilated area. Avoid direct sunlight to prevent fading or damage. If using a drying rack, ensure the gear is laid flat to prevent stretching or distortion.

  • Post-Cleaning Inspection: After cleaning, re-inspect the gear for any damage. Addressing any newly discovered issues or imperfections will extend the gear’s lifespan and prevent further deterioration.

Storage Procedures

Proper storage prevents damage and maintains the gear’s integrity. Carefully consider the storage environment and avoid conditions that could cause mold, mildew, or other damage.

  • Storage Location: Store the gear in a dry, clean, and well-ventilated area, away from direct sunlight and extreme temperatures. Avoid storing the gear in damp or humid environments, as this can lead to mold growth and damage.
  • Packing Techniques: Roll or fold the gear carefully to avoid creases or wrinkles. Store the gear in airtight containers or bags to prevent moisture from seeping in. Consider using silica gel packets to absorb any residual moisture in the storage container. Packing should minimize the potential for abrasion and stretching of the gear during storage.

Influence of Environmental Factors on Gear Requirements

The effectiveness of cold weather gear is highly dependent on environmental conditions. Wind chill significantly reduces the body’s ability to retain heat. Higher wind speeds necessitate increased insulation in the outer layers to prevent heat loss. Snow conditions, particularly depth and density, can affect the mobility and performance of soldiers, influencing the need for specific footwear and outerwear.

The presence of ice and snow also impacts the durability of the gear, requiring consideration of appropriate waterproofing and protective coatings.
